This was one of the toughest hikes I've ever done requiring crampons, ice axe, and glacier glasses. And it was one of the most amazingly awesome hikes. Around 14,000 foot elevation it took around 7 hours to ascend and 3 to descend because we glissaded all the way to the bottom (sled on your butt down the snow using…

Mount Shasta is one of the most exquisitely beautiful and serene places of the planet. A dormant volcano towering over 14,000 over the Shasta Valley at 3000 feet, Mount Shasta can be seen from 200 miles away in the Central Valley on a clear day.
